A Memorial Service for Rev. Larry Montgomery, was held at the First Free Will Baptist Church, Checotah, OK, on July 14, 2014.
He was the youngest son of Raymond C. and Marie (Bain) Montgomery. He grew up in the rural community of Non, Hughes County, OK., and graduated Calvin HS in 1962. He was active in church as a teenager and his pastor, Rev. Roma Stewart, asked him to go to a summer session with him at the FWB College in Nashville, and from there he found his calling in life. He began to preach in his senior year of HS.
He met and married Sammie Raylene Bond, of Ada, and they began their life's work together. He went to OK State Univ. at Stillwater, where he completed a Master's Degree, while pastoring a mission church there which needed help. He then went to Nashville, TN for more theological training and received another Master's degree.
He pastored in several states: in Aurora, Ill.; spent several years in a pastorate in Hollywood, FL; Cofer's Chapel Church, Nashville; in Georgia...and then relocated to Ada First Church, OK, and at last to First FWB church in Checotah, for several years of fruitful ministry from which he had just retired this year. He began having health problems, and at last he was not able to overcome the gravity of his condition. He was ready to move to his new home. His wife of over 50 yrs survives him as well as a son, Todd, Tenn, and a daughter, Rev. Carmen Cook, Mich. Also, two grandchildren, Tenn; two brothers Roger Montgomery of Kansas, and Roy Montgomery of Oregon, and sister-in-law, Louise Montgomery, Calvin, OK. Several nephews and nieces as well as many cousins. His parents and a bro. Jerry Montgomery, preceded him in death.
A large host of family and friends are saddened by his passing.
